Quantinuum posted its first earnings since going public — revenue beat but losses widened
Quantinuum posted its first earnings since going public, reporting $8 million in second-quarter revenue, which represents a 279% increase year over year. Despite the significant revenue beat, the company reported that its GAAP net loss swelled to $597 million.
